Under the direction of Mr. Joseph Romano, the Winter Wind Ensemble is an extra-curricular group comprised of some of the best woodwind players that MacArthur High School has to offer. The ensemble began practices back in October to prepare a repertoire of more than two dozen winter holiday selections. On Dec. 6, their first concert took place before the meeting of the Levittown Board of Education meeting, earning a rousing ovation from the audience. The performance closed out with audience participation as they jingled their keys along to "Jingle Bells."

The Winter Wind Ensemble is also set to perform on Dec. 18 at the Broadway Mall in Hicksville, offering joyful music for all shoppers and mall employees. Additionally, on Dec. 22, they will perform "mini concerts" in the halls of MacArthur for all passersby to enjoy.

This year's Winter Wind Ensemble was led by some talented musicians including seniors Maggie Chen and Kyle Parmentier on bass clarinet; Hailey Metzger and Marissa Payne on flute; Daniel Lee, Roberto Oquendo and Nicholas Stallone on clarinet; and Jacob Yousha on percussion.
